Use Case Grok Bot turned out to be a surprisingly goated host for Hermes agent
i originally asked Grok Bot what I could actually do with its persistent always-on cloud computer, and one of the things it suggested was connecting it to my Tailscale tailnet. That sounded legit genius, so I did it.
A bit later I had the idea to just run my Hermes agent there remotely. I made a separate “Hermes technician” bot that installed Hermes for me, set up a keepalive for the gateway, and got the basic stuff working. After that I configured the rest from inside Hermes itself.
So now Hermes just lives on the Grok Bot machine 24/7. I can talk to it through Telegram, or connect from any of my computers with the desktop Hermes app. Since everything is on my tailnet, it can SSH into my other machines and still use the native Hermes features like app control and stuff like that.
Probably my favorite part is that Hermes is running through Grok OAuth, so the whole setup basically runs off the same SuperGrok subscription.
